FMS Explorer provides a detailed audit history trail for several externally audited FMS records, providing insight into the user workflow process for the selected record.
The Audit History dialog box can be accessed via the Audit History button found in the following locations.

Click the Audit History button to access the Audit History dialog box for the item selected.
The following fields appear in the Audit History dialog box. In addition, the bottom left portion of the dialog box status bar displays the audit history results (e.g. "Got 3 changes" in the example above).
